Transaction ff31dfd6d7936f21253236c6765887806e9097ba1fc28ed70090d86ba6e957cb
1 Input
1 Output
-
ff31dfd6d7936f21253236c6765887806e9097ba1fc28ed70090d86ba6e957cb:0
- value
- 1704063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c398ae59699b07cff714285ce5c927435f009a84 OP_EQUAL
- address
- 3KXEbR6AdVwABtewfMXdHaSx2b9gKQ7zMC